The ingredients needed to make Rasgulla:
  1. Get 1/2 litre milk
  2. Make ready 1 cup Sugar
  3. Make ready 1/2 spoon Lemon/vinegar
  4. Make ready 2 cup Water

Instructions to make Rasgulla:
  1. Boil the milk and add lemon or vinegar until cheese (chenna) gets separated.
  2. Pour in a cloth or filter and strain the whey water completely.
  3. Knead the chenna with mild pressure and make balls. Pour 2 cup of water in a cooker with 1 cup sugar.
  4. Once sugar melts add the chenna balls and leave it upto 3 whistle.
  5. Rasgulla is ready to serve hot or chilled.
  6. Note: Make sure you have enough spaced vessel. Chenna ball will rise 3 times bigger size once cooked. No need to add semolina as it will change the authentic taste.
